Poor Work Cultures and Trauma Bonding With Your ColleaguesIf you have uttered any of these statements, you may have a trauma bond with your workplace and your colleagues…"I know the workplace is toxic, but I can't imagine leaving. We've been through so much together.""I keep hoping things will get better, that they'll appreciate my dedication and hard work eventually.""I can't speak up about the issues because I'm afraid of the consequences. It's like we're all in this together.""Despite the stress, I can't envision myself anywhere else. We've become a sort of dysfunctional family.""I know I'm not happy, but leaving would feel like abandoning ship. We've weathered so much together.""There's a strange camaraderie here, even if it's born out of shared misery. It's hard to let that go."In today's fast-paced and competitive work environments, it is common for individuals to spend more time with their colleagues than with their own families. This can create a unique dynamic where employees form deep connections with their coworkers, often referred to as "workplace families." While a positive work culture can foster a sense of belonging and support, a toxic work environment can lead to trauma bonding among colleagues.
